13 Example Sentences Showcasing the Meaning of 'Railroading'

The defense argued that the prosecutor was railroading their client into accepting a plea deal.

The company's management was accused of railroading employees into signing unfair contracts.

The political candidate claimed that his opponent was railroading the election by spreading false information.

The activists accused the government of railroading environmental policies without considering public input.

The judge warned against railroading the witness during cross-examination.

The student council president was accused of railroading decisions without consulting other members.

The journalist wrote an article exposing corrupt practices of railroading in the construction industry.

The professor emphasized the importance of critical thinking to prevent railroading in academic research.

The manager tried railroading the new policy without consulting the team, causing confusion among the employees.

Emily regretted railroading through the book, realizing later that she missed the subtle details in the plot.

The chef emphasized the importance of not railroading the cooking process, as patience is key to achieving the perfect flavors.

Mark felt guilty for railroading his sister into choosing the movie he wanted to watch, ignoring her preferences.

The scientist cautioned against railroading the experimentation phase, as thorough testing was crucial to obtaining accurate results.
